@Mike_Laidlaw Hello Mr. Laidlaw, a brief question: will we be able to alter our characters physique in Dragon Age Inquisition?

@LeonA01371176 [Yes.] We're investing in supporting 4 race body types... 2 bodies per race, 1 male, 1 female.
